Delta Lake: Revolutionizing Data Management Through Intelligent Compaction
The Data Dilemma: A Personal Journey into Modern Data Engineering
Imagine standing at the crossroads of technological innovation, where massive data streams converge and traditional storage approaches crumble under unprecedented complexity. This is where our story of Delta Lake begins – a narrative of transformation, efficiency, and intelligent data management.
As a data engineering veteran who has witnessed the evolution of storage technologies, I‘ve seen firsthand the challenges that modern organizations face. The exponential growth of data isn‘t just a technical challenge; it‘s a strategic battlefield where performance, reliability, and insights compete for supremacy.
The Emergence of Delta Lake: More Than Just a Storage Solution
Delta Lake represents more than a technological upgrade – it‘s a paradigm shift in how we conceptualize and manage data. Born from the complex needs of large-scale data processing, it addresses fundamental limitations that have plagued traditional data lake architectures.
Understanding the Technical Landscape
Traditional data lakes often resembled chaotic warehouses – massive storage spaces filled with unstructured, poorly managed data. Each file, each fragment represented potential insight buried under layers of complexity. Delta Lake emerged as a sophisticated curator, bringing order to this digital chaos.
[Complexity Reduction = f(Intelligent Compaction, Metadata Management)]The Compaction Revolution: Transforming Raw Data into Strategic Assets
Compaction in Delta Lake isn‘t merely a technical process; it‘s an intelligent optimization strategy that fundamentally reimagines data storage. By consolidating smaller files and creating more efficient storage structures, Delta Lake transforms raw data into strategic organizational assets.
Technical Mechanics of Intelligent Compaction
The compaction process operates through multiple sophisticated mechanisms:
-
Adaptive File Consolidation
Data files are dynamically merged based on complex algorithms that analyze access patterns, size, and organizational requirements. This isn‘t just file merging – it‘s strategic data orchestration. -
Metadata-Driven Optimization
Each compaction cycle generates rich metadata, creating a comprehensive understanding of data evolution. This metadata becomes a strategic resource, enabling more intelligent future processing.
Performance Metrics: Beyond Traditional Benchmarks
Let‘s explore the tangible impact of Delta Lake‘s compaction strategies through real-world performance metrics:
| Performance Dimension | Traditional Approach | Delta Lake Optimization | Improvement Percentage |
|---|---|---|---|
| Storage Efficiency | 40-50% Overhead | 10-15% Overhead | 70-80% Reduction |
| Query Latency | 200-300 milliseconds | 50-100 milliseconds | 60-75% Acceleration |
| Metadata Management | Complex Transactions | Streamlined Operations | 85% Efficiency Gain |
Machine Learning Integration: The Next Frontier
Delta Lake‘s architecture isn‘t just about storage – it‘s a sophisticated platform for advanced machine learning workflows. By providing consistent, reliable data structures, it enables more complex predictive modeling and analytical processes.
Predictive Data Management
Machine learning models require consistent, well-structured data. Delta Lake‘s compaction mechanisms create an ideal environment for training sophisticated algorithms, reducing noise and improving overall model performance.
Enterprise Transformation: Real-World Implementation Strategies
Implementing Delta Lake isn‘t a technical upgrade – it‘s a strategic organizational transformation. Successful adoption requires a holistic approach that considers:
- Existing technological infrastructure
- Organizational data processing requirements
- Future scalability needs
- Integration with existing machine learning pipelines
Cloud-Native Architecture: The Future of Data Management
As cloud technologies continue evolving, Delta Lake represents a critical bridge between traditional storage approaches and next-generation data processing architectures. Its flexible, scalable design allows seamless integration with modern cloud environments.
Serverless Potential
The serverless computing model finds a perfect companion in Delta Lake‘s intelligent compaction strategies. By reducing storage overhead and improving data accessibility, it enables more efficient, cost-effective cloud deployments.
Emerging Trends and Future Perspectives
The future of data management lies in intelligent, self-optimizing systems. Delta Lake is not just a technology – it‘s a glimpse into a world where data becomes a living, breathing ecosystem of insights.
Potential future developments include:
- AI-driven compaction strategies
- Predictive metadata management
- Enhanced cross-platform compatibility
- More granular data governance mechanisms
The Human Element: Transforming Data into Insights
Behind every technical advancement lies a fundamental human story – the quest to understand, organize, and derive meaning from complex information. Delta Lake represents more than a technological solution; it‘s a testament to human ingenuity in managing increasingly complex digital landscapes.
Conclusion: A New Chapter in Data Engineering
As we stand at the intersection of technological innovation and strategic data management, Delta Lake offers a compelling vision of the future. It‘s not just about storing data – it‘s about transforming raw information into strategic organizational assets.
For data engineers, machine learning professionals, and technology leaders, Delta Lake represents more than a tool. It‘s a philosophy of intelligent, efficient, and strategic data management.
The journey continues, and the possibilities are limitless.
